Hyaluronic Acid Creams: A Guide

Topical hyaluronic acid is a popular ingredient in skincare products. This is a naturally occurring substance present in our skin that helps to hold onto moisture. When applied topically, hyaluronic acid can draw water from the air and seal it onto the skin, resulting in moisturized looking skin.

There are hyaluronic acid products available on the market. These range from gels and masks to moisturizers. It's important to choose a product that is right for your skin type.

People with dry skin, a hydrating hyaluronic acid product may be best. People Sitio web with oily or acne-prone skin may do well with a lightweight hyaluronic acid gel.

Using topical hyaluronic acid, it is suggested you apply it after cleansing for best results.

Understanding Hyaluronic Acid Injections

Hyaluronic acid injections are a popular cosmetic procedure used to alleviate the appearance of wrinkles, fine lines, and other signs of aging. The procedure utilizes injecting a gel-like substance made from hyaluronic acid into specific areas of treatment. Hyaluronic acid is naturally present in tissues and helps to hydrate moisture.

  • Leading up to the procedure, a doctor will assess your skin type and expectations.
  • The injection process itself is usually quick, taking minutes to complete.
  • Throughout the the procedure, a topical anesthetic may be applied to minimize any unpleasantness.

Results from hyaluronic acid injections are typically visible immediately and continue to improve over the next few weeks. The effects remain visible for a duration of time depending on individual conditions.

Exploring the Power of Hyaluronic Acid

Hyaluronic acid exists as a fundamental component in our bodies. It attracts and retains moisture, keeping tissues hydrated and plump . This unique property makes it beneficial for a variety of applications has earned it recognition in both cosmetic and medical spheres.

In skincare, hyaluronic acid is widely utilized in hydrating the skin and re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. Its ability to attract and hold water molecules makes it an effective ingredient in moisturizers, serums, and masks.

Beyond skincare, hyaluronic acid has also shown promise in wound healing . Its ability to promote cell growth and migration makes it a valuable candidate for various medical applications.

  • Hyaluronic acid injections offer a safe and effective way to enhance facial contours
  • Some individuals find that taking hyaluronic acid supplements improve joint health and reduce pain associated with osteoarthritis.
